Ergonomics studies in Thailand: a future prospect.

Abstract

Ergonomics studies in Thailand began in 1967 after Professor Kovit Satavuthi graduated from the University of Birmingham, where he worked with Professor Nigel Corlett. Ergonomics was offered as an elective in the IE curriculum at Chulalongkorn University. Professor Satavuthi was later invited to teach manufacturing process and system at the Department of Occupational Health and Safety, School of Public Health, Mahidol University. He then added the ergonomics concept to the class as part of his lectures. The first international conference was organized by the Central Coordinating Board of SEAMEO-TROPMED Project, and it was held in Bangkok from 19-23 June 1972, thus bringing ergonomics into public attention. Most participants came from medical science and public health fields, however. Ergonomics popularity has begun to gain momentum in the past 4-5 years. This could be the result of more universities paying serious consideration to provide ergonomics knowledge to their students. It is also well-accepted that ergonomics is a multidisciplined subject. It requires knowledge from medical sciences, sociology, psychology, public health, and engineering. The results of ergonomics studies will have greater chances of success if they are concluded from all disciplines of knowledge. This paper reports some previous studies in Thailand and discuss how to build up an ergonomics team and to produce reasonable results with a sound application plan.
